160,000 patients visited Jordan to receive treatment through 10 months
Al-Anbat -Rahaf Abdullah
160,000 patients visited Jordan for treatment since the
beginning of this year until the end of last October, an increase of 27%
compared with the same period of last year, according to the President of the
Private Hospitals Association, Fawzi Al-Hammoury, on Tuesday.
He added in his speech to Almamlakah, which is an optimistic
in this current world, noting at the same time that the numbers did not return
as what were before Corona.
Al-hammory showed that Jordan is characterized by performing
delicate operations such as heart and organ transplants.
He make sure that the World Forum for Medical Treatment and
Health Travel focuses on the important of rule of ambassadorial in marketing to
Jordan as a destination for local tourism.
He called to stimulate Jordan's medical sector by reducing
income taxes and sales and facilitating the mechanism of entry into Jordan.
He pointed out for the issue of reconsidering taxes on the
sector is still "suspended".
